Support for Fibromyalgia

Fibromyalgia is a disorder where a person suffers from serious aches and pains all over the body. The areas that are most generally affected are the back, neck, shoulders and hands. Patients experience pain that ranges in intensity throughout their body. An estimated ten million people in the United States have fibromyalgia. Although it affects more women than men, all men, women and children can encounter the disorder.

The National Fibromyalgia Association (NFA) is an organization designed to educate the public. There are support groups in every state throughout the country. If you would like to learn more about the support they have available, you can contact them through the mail or online.

The NFA is designed to encourage and empower the patients and their families that deal with fibromyalgia. In addition to learning through their support groups, you can also join the association and can receive special member benefits such as their quarterly newsletter, Fibromyalgia Awareness Magazine, plus additional benefits. They also host an annual workshop that instructs attendees about fibromyalgia. The 2007 workshop was held in Washington, DC.

There are several support groups that are also available online. These groups offer different types of assistance like wellness blogs, treatment information, a place where patients can write about their own stories and even chat rooms. This is a wonderful opportunity to get some help if you don't want to leave your home.

Of course, the type of support that interests you entirely up to you and your family. You can even test a support group before you join to see what works for you. There are many different types of support groups that are available.
